首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

列表计数的相同字符

是指对一个列表中的字符进行统计,找出出现次数相同的字符,并将它们按照出现次数从高到低进行排序。

在云计算领域,可以使用各种编程语言和算法来实现列表计数的相同字符。以下是一个示例的实现过程:

  1. 遍历列表中的每个字符,使用一个字典(或哈希表)来记录每个字符出现的次数。
  2. 如果字符已经在字典中存在,则将对应的计数加1;否则,在字典中新增该字符,并将计数初始化为1。
  3. 遍历完所有字符后,根据字符出现的次数进行排序,可以使用排序算法(如快速排序、归并排序等)或优先队列(如堆排序)来实现。
  4. 输出排序后的结果,即按照出现次数从高到低排列的字符列表。

这种列表计数的方法可以应用于各种场景,例如统计文本中单词的出现次数、分析用户行为中的点击次数、处理日志文件中的异常频率等。

在腾讯云的产品中,可以使用云函数(SCF)来实现列表计数的相同字符。云函数是一种无服务器计算服务,可以根据事件触发自动运行代码。您可以编写一个云函数,将列表作为输入参数,然后在函数中实现列表计数的逻辑。通过配置触发器,您可以将云函数与其他腾讯云产品(如对象存储 COS、消息队列 CMQ 等)进行集成,实现更复杂的应用场景。

更多关于腾讯云云函数的信息,请访问腾讯云云函数产品介绍页面:腾讯云云函数

请注意,以上答案仅供参考,具体实现方式和推荐产品可能因实际需求和环境而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【译】CSS列表,标记,计数

本文,会首先讲解CSS列表,然后把目光转移到CSS列表规范中一些有趣特性——标记和计数器。 在CSS中,列表具有特定属性,为我们提供了标准列表样式。...大多数情况下,回退到常规标记符将会是一个合理解决方案。 计数器 有序列表编号是通过CSS计数器实现,因此,CSS列表规范中也描述了计数器。...counters()函数第一个参数是计数器名,这里使用是内置计数器list-item,第二个参数是个字符串——用于连接输出计数器(这里使用是一个.符号)。...可以试着将字符串.符号改为其他内容,看其输出是如何变化) counter() 和 counters() 有何区别?...counters()函数实际上可以实现整个嵌套列表计数,并且可以用字符串来连接各分支上计数

1.2K30

Python元组与列表相同点与区别

列表和元组都属于有序序列,支持使用双向索引访问其中元素、使用内置函数len()统计元素个数、使用运算符in测试是否包含某个元素、使用count()方法统计指定元素出现次数和index()方法获取指定元素索引...虽然有着一定相似之处,但列表和元组在本质上和内部实现上都有着很大不同。 元组属于不可变(immutable)序列,一旦创建,不允许修改元组中元素值,也无法为元组增加或删除元素。...从一定程度上讲,可以认为元组是轻量级列表,或者“常量列表”。 Python内部实现对元组做了大量优化,访问速度比列表更快。...如果定义了一系列常量值,主要用途仅是对它们进行遍历或其他类似用途,而不需要对其元素进行任何修改,那么一般建议使用元组而不用列表。...最后,作为不可变序列,与整数、字符串一样,元组可用作字典键,也可以作为集合元素,而列表则永远都不能当做字典键使用,也不能作为集合中元素,因为列表不是不可变,或者说不可哈希。

1.6K60

Python字符填充和计数

zfill 函数 功能 为字符串定义长度,如不满足,缺少部分用 0 填充 用法 newstr = string.zfill(width) 参数 width: 新字符串希望宽度 注意事项 与字符字符无关...如果定义长度小于当前字符串长度,则不发生变化 代码 # coding:utf-8 heart = 'love' if __name__ == '__main__': print(...heart.zfill(9)) print(heart.zfill(8)) print(heart.zfill(6)) print(heart.zfill(4)) 字符...count 函数 功能 返回当前字符串中某个成员 (元素) 个数 用法 inttpe = string.count(item) 参数 item: 查询个数元素 注意事项 返回是整形 如果查询成员...info.count('f') print(a, b, c, d, e, f) number_list = [a, b, c, d, e, f] print(number_list) print('在列表中最大数值是

1K20

LeetCode-1247-交换字符使得字符相同

# LeetCode-1247-交换字符使得字符相同 有两个长度相同字符串 s1 和 s2,且它们其中 只含有 字符 "x" 和 "y",你需要通过「交换字符方式使这两个字符相同。...每次「交换字符时候,你都可以在两个字符串中各选一个字符进行交换。 交换只能发生在两个不同字符串之间,绝对不能发生在同一个字符串内部。...最后,请你返回使 s1 和 s2 相同最小交换次数,如果没有方法能够使得这两个字符相同,则返回 -1 。...注意,你不能交换 s1[0] 和 s1[1] 使得 s1 变成 "yx",因为我们只能交换属于两个不同字符字符。...,当s1=x、s2=y时,记录位x++;当s1=y、s2=x时,记录位y++ 通过判断x和y个数,计算最少交换字符次数 如果x+y是奇数,则返回-1,因为这说明最后还剩下一对,x和y,单字符无法进行交换

31610

交换字符使得字符相同

题目 有两个长度相同字符串 s1 和 s2,且它们其中 只含有 字符 “x” 和 “y”,你需要通过「交换字符方式使这两个字符相同。...每次「交换字符时候,你都可以在两个字符串中各选一个字符进行交换。 交换只能发生在两个不同字符串之间,绝对不能发生在同一个字符串内部。...最后,请你返回使 s1 和 s2 相同最小交换次数,如果没有方法能够使得这两个字符相同,则返回 -1 。...注意,你不能交换 s1[0] 和 s1[1] 使得 s1 变成 "yx",因为我们只能交换属于两个不同字符字符。...解题 统计不相同位:x-y 或者 y-x x-y,x-y,出现2次,交换1次即可使之相等 同理y-x, y-x,出现2次,交换1次即可 最后如果存在单个,不能交换使之相等 如果存在一个x-y, y-x

1.4K20

MySQL括号字符计数

*b,它将会匹配最长以a开始,以b结束字符串。如果用它来搜索aabab的话,它会匹配整个字符串aabab。这被称为贪婪匹配。....*`, 它将会匹配以 src=` 开始,以`结束最长字符串。...跟在“*”后边用时,表示懒惰模式,也称非贪婪模式,就是匹配尽可能少字符。这就意味着匹配任意数量重复,但是在能使整个匹配成功前提下使用最少重复。a.*?b匹配最短,以a开始,以b结束字符串。...`,它将会匹配 src=` 开始,以 ` 结束尽可能短字符串,且开始和结束中间可以没有字符,因为*表示零到多个。...9-11行中子查询为每个带有“]”符号,并且最后一个字符不是“]”评论尾部拼接一个“]”字符

1.3K20

【Python】列表 List ① ( 数据容器简介 | 列表 List 定义语法 | 列表中存储类型相同元素 | 列表中存储类型不同元素 | 列表嵌套 )

一、数据容器简介 Python 中 数据容器 数据类型 可以 存放多个数据 , 每个数据都称为 元素 , 容器 元素 类型可以是任意类型 ; Python 数据容器 根据 如下不同特点 : 是否允许元素重复...是否允许修改 是否排序 分为五大类 : 列表 List 元组 tuple 字符串 str 集合 set 字典 dict 下面从 列表 List 开始逐个进行介绍 ; 二、列表 List 简介 1、列表定义语法...列表定义语法 : 列表标识 : 使用 中括号 [] 作为 列表 标识 ; 列表元素 : 列表元素之间 , 使用逗号隔开 ; 定义 列表 字面量 : 将元素直接写在中括号中 , 多个元素之间使用逗号隔开...或者 list() 表示空列表 ; # 空列表定义 变量 = [] 变量 = list() 上述定义 列表 语句中 , 列表元素类型是可以不同 , 在同一个列表中 , 可以同时存在 字符串 和...数字类型 ; 2、代码示例 - 列表中存储类型相同元素 代码示例 : """ 列表 List 代码示例 """ # 定义列表类 names = ["Tom", "Jerry", "Jack"] #

21820

iOS 查找字符相同字符位置 range

问题:解决替换同一个字符多个相同字符eg.  xxx这个超级大土豪白送xxx一个!赶快来抢把!...@"顺风车":_m_dataDic[@"content"])]; //第二种方法(思路 首先遍历这个字符串 然后找到所有的xxx 所在位置index    然后通过index将字符串进行替换)        ...stringByReplacingCharactersInRange:NSMakeRange([arrayShare[0]integerValue], 3) withString:_m_dataDic[@"nickName"]]; //获取这个字符串中所有...xxx所在index - (NSMutableArray *)getRangeStr:(NSString *)text findText:(NSString *)findText {     NSMutableArray...                rang1 = NSMakeRange(location, length);             }             //在一个range范围内查找另一个字符

3.6K50

leetcode之两个相同字符之间最长子字符

序 本文主要记录一下leetcode之两个相同字符之间最长子字符串 substring-function-in-javascript.png 题目 给你一个字符串 s,请你返回 两个相同字符之间最长子字符长度...如果不存在这样字符串,返回 -1 。 子字符串 是字符串中一个连续字符序列。 示例 1: 输入:s = "aa" 输出:0 解释:最优字符串是两个 'a' 之间空子字符串。...示例 4: 输入:s = "cabbac" 输出:4 解释:最优字符串是 "abba" ,其他非最优解包括 "bb" 和 "" 。...,在遍历字符时候,遇到相同字符时候,计算前后下标的差来得出子字符长度,然后通过对比记录最长字符长度。...doc 两个相同字符之间最长子字符

1.5K00

leetcode之两个相同字符之间最长子字符

序 本文主要记录一下leetcode之两个相同字符之间最长子字符串 题目 给你一个字符串 s,请你返回 两个相同字符之间最长子字符长度 ,计算长度时不含这两个字符。...如果不存在这样字符串,返回 -1 。 子字符串 是字符串中一个连续字符序列。 示例 1: 输入:s = "aa" 输出:0 解释:最优字符串是两个 'a' 之间空子字符串。...示例 4: 输入:s = "cabbac" 输出:4 解释:最优字符串是 "abba" ,其他非最优解包括 "bb" 和 "" 。...,在遍历字符时候,遇到相同字符时候,计算前后下标的差来得出子字符长度,然后通过对比记录最长字符长度。...doc 两个相同字符之间最长子字符

2.1K10

华为OD机试 相同字符连续出现最大次数

本期题目:相同字符连续出现最大次数 题目 输入一串字符字符串长度不超过100 查找字符串中相同字符连续出现最大次数 输入 输入只有一行,包含一个长度不超过100字符串 输出描述 输出只有一行...,输出相同字符串连续出现最大次数 思路 遍历字符串,对于每个字符统计其连续出现次数,更新最大值即可。...首先,华为OD机试可以在在线评测方式下,快速地组织面试,以最短时间内筛选出符合面试要求应聘者。其次,通过华为OD机试,企业可以更好地了解应聘者编程能力,判断其是否具备应聘岗位基本要求。...其次,由于华为OD机试测试用例和难度等级不同,可能会出现一些偏差和误差,需要企业在评估结果时进行合理考虑和判断。...最后,华为OD机试结果也需要与其他面试环节进行配合使用,才能更加准确地评估应聘者实际能力。

47920

两个相同字符之间最长子字符

题目 给你一个字符串 s,请你返回 两个相同字符之间最长子字符长度 ,计算长度时不含这两个字符。如果不存在这样字符串,返回 -1 。 子字符串 是字符串中一个连续字符序列。...示例 1: 输入:s = "aa" 输出:0 解释:最优字符串是两个 'a' 之间空子字符串。 示例 2: 输入:s = "abca" 输出:2 解释:最优字符串是 "bc" 。...示例 3: 输入:s = "cbzxy" 输出:-1 解释:s 中不存在出现出现两次字符,所以返回 -1 。...示例 4: 输入:s = "cabbac" 输出:4 解释:最优字符串是 "abba" ,其他非最优解包括 "bb" 和 "" 。...解题 记录每个字符出现第一次位置,和最后一次位置 class Solution { public: int maxLengthBetweenEqualCharacters(string s

1.4K20
领券